加权k-means算法在推荐系统中的应用
发布时间: 2024-03-15 12:10:45 阅读量: 62 订阅数: 26
# 1. 引言
在推荐系统领域,加权k-means算法作为一种聚类算法,被广泛应用于用户数据的分析和个性化推荐。本文将介绍加权k-means算法在推荐系统中的应用,探讨其优势和挑战,以及实际案例分析。通过深入了解这一算法及其在推荐系统中的作用,读者能够更好地理解推荐系统的运作原理和优化方法。
文章结构概述:
1. 引言:介绍本文的研究背景和意义,概述文章结构。
2. 推荐系统概述:阐述推荐系统的定义、分类、基本原理和评价指标。
3. 加权k-means算法简介:回顾k-means算法的基本原理,介绍加权k-means算法的概念和优势。
4. 推荐系统中的k-means算法应用:探讨k-means算法在推荐系统中的应用概况及挑战。
5. 加权k-means算法在推荐系统中的实际案例:展示加权k-means算法在不同领域的实际应用案例。
6. 结论与展望:总结文章要点,展望加权k-means算法在推荐系统中的未来发展方向。
通过阅读本文,读者将对推荐系统和加权k-means算法有更深入的理解,为实际应用提供参考和启示。
# 2. 推荐系统概述
推荐系统在当前互联网应用中扮演着越来越重要的角色,它可以帮助用户在海量信息中快速找到符合个性化需求的内容,提高用户体验及平台粘性。本章将对推荐系统进行概述,包括定义、分类、基本原理和评价指标等内容。
### 推荐系统的定义与分类
推荐系统是一种信息过滤系统,根据用户的历史行为和偏好,预测和推荐可能感兴趣的物品(如商品、音乐、视频等),以减少信息过载的问题。根据推荐方式的不同,推荐系统可分为基于内容的推荐、协同过滤推荐和混合推荐等多种类型。
### 推荐系统的基本原理
推荐系统的基本原理主要包括协同过滤、内容分析、基于关联规则的推荐等方法。其中,协同过滤是最常见的推荐算法,分为基于用户的协同过滤和基于物品的协同过滤两种。
### 推荐系统的评价指标
为了评估推荐系统的性能,需要借助一些常见的评价指标,如准确率、召回率、覆盖率、多样性和个性化等指标。这些指标可以帮助开发者量化评估推荐系统的效果,指导进一步的优化和改进工作。
# 3. 加权k-means算法简介
在本章中,我们将介绍加权k-means算法的基本原理及其在推荐系统中的应用。加权k-means算法是一种对标准k-means算法的改进,通过引入权重来调整聚类过程中不同特征的重要性。接下来,我们将深入探讨加权k-means算法的概念、优势以及在聚类中的应用。
**k-means算法基本原理回顾**
在k-means算法中,首先选择k个聚类中心,然后将数据点分配到最近的聚类中心,并根据分配结果更新聚类中心的位置。这个过程不断迭代,直到聚类中心不再发生明显变化或达到预定的迭代次数,最终收敛得到k个簇。
**加权k-means算法的概念及优势**
加权k-means算法在标准k-means算法的基础上引入了样本点的权重信息,即不同样本点对聚类中心的贡献度不同。通过调整不同样本点的权重,使得算法更加灵活,能够处理不同重要性的特征。
**加权k-means算法在聚类中的应用**
加权k-means算法在聚类中的应用十分
0
0